RENORMALIZATION FOR NUCLEON-ANTINUCLEON INTERACTION

The divergences associated with the integral equation for nucleon- antinucleon (N-N) interaction derived in the preceding paper (Mitra axena 1960) are analyzed in detail. The problem is found to be quite sithilar to that discussed by Dalitz yson (1955) in connection with the pi -N problem. The part of the wave function representing the specific effects of the anninilation interaction is found to be expressed in terms of the so-called vertex operator and a raeson propagator mcdified by self-energy effects. The ventex operator is then renormalized and the finite (observable) effects of this renormalization on the N-N wavefunction evaluated. It is found that, unlike the case of pi -N scattering where two different renormalization factors are needed for describings- and p-wave interactions, the present problem requires a unique renormalization constant covering both cdd and even angular momentum states.
